一种大型车辆车轮自动降温与报警控制装置设计

摘要: 大型车辆在长下坡的过程中,由于自身载重大、速度快的特点,只能使用不断制动减速的办法保证安全,在此过程中车辆制动盘的温度会不断上升,最终出现制动“热衰退”,导致制动失效。在分析现有各种降低车辆车轮降温措施的技术基础上,设计出新的车轮自动降温与报警控制装置。当大型车辆车轮出现高温时,单片机接收到温度探侧器的温度信号,通过语音提示,提醒本车驾驶员注意;通过鼓风机工作,实现用压缩空气给制动盘降温。

关键词: 大型车辆, 热衰退, 自动降温与报警, 控制装置
